ControlLogix High Speed Counter Module
ControlLogix High Speed Counter Module
| Unique Product Identifier |
1756-HSC
|
|---|---|
| UPC |
612598186280
|
| Estimated Lead Time |
147 days
|
| Standard Warranty Duration |
1 year See details |
| Country of Origin |
United States of America
|
| Conducted RF immunity |
10V rms with 1 kHz sine wave 80% AM from 150 kHz...80 MHz on shielded signal ports
|
|---|---|
| EFT/B immunity |
±4kV @ 5kHz on power ports, ±4kV @ 5kHz on signal ports
|
| ESD immunity |
6 kV contact discharges, 8 kV air discharges
|
| Emissions |
IEC 61000-6-4
|
| Nonoperating temperature |
-40 °C
|
| North American temperature code |
T4
|
| Operating temperature |
0 to 60 °C
|
| Radiated RF immunity |
10 V/m with 1 kHz sine-wave 80% AM from 80...2000 MHz, 10 V/m with 200 Hz 50% Pulse 100% AM @ 900 MHz, 10 V/m with 200 Hz 50% Pulse 100% AM @ 1890 MHz, 3 V/m with 1 kHz sine-wave 80% AM from 2000...2700 MHz
|
| Relative humidity |
5...95% noncondensing
|
| Surge transient immunity |
±1 kV line-line (DM) and ±2 kV line-earth (CM) on power ports, ±1 kV line-line (DM) and ±2 kV line-earth (CM) on signal ports, ±2 kV line-earth (CM) on shielded ports
|
| Surrounding air temperature, max |
60 °C
|
| Current draw |
300mA @ 5.1V, 3mA @ 24V
|
|---|---|
| Digital inputs configurable |
True
|
| Digital outputs configurable |
False
|
| Inputs per counter |
3 (A, B, Z for gate/reset)
|
| Isolation voltage |
125V (continuous), basic insulation type, input group-to-backplane, 30V (continuous), basic insulation type, input group-to-input group
|
| Module keying |
Electronic, software configurable
|
| Number of counters |
2 counters
|
| Outputs |
4 (2 points/group)
|
| Power dissipation, max |
5.6 W @ 60 °C(140 °F)
|
| Short-circuit protection, outputs available |
False
|
| Suitable for safety functions |
False
|
| Thermal dissipation |
19.1 btu/h
|
| Total backplane power |
1.6 W
|
| Type of electric connection |
Screw connection
|
| Voltage type of supply voltage |
DC
|
| Wire category |
2 on signal ports, 1 on power ports
|
| Count range |
0...16, 777, 214
|
|---|---|
| Counting frequency, max |
1000 khz
|
| Input current, min |
4 mA
|
| Input current, nom |
15 mA
|
| Input frequency, max |
1 MHz in counter modes (A input), 500 kHz in rate measurement mode (A input), 250 kHz in encoder mode (A/B inputs, X1 or X4), 70 Hz with filter enabled
|
| Operating voltage |
5V ops: 4.5...5.5V DC @ 12/24V ops: 10...26.4V DC
|
| Counter, max |
1 mhz
|
|---|---|
| Current limit |
<4 A
|
| Debounce filter, max |
70 Hz
|
| Encoder, max |
250 khz
|
| Load current per point, min |
5V ops: 3mA @ 12/24V ops: 40 mA
|
| Off-state leakage current per point, max |
300 µA
|
| On-state voltage drop, max |
0.55 V
|
| Output control |
Up to two outputs are assigned to each counter channel, each output can have two ‘turn-on’ and ’turn-off’ preset values
|
| Output current rating, per point |
20mA @ 4.5...5.5V DC, 1.0A @ 10...31.2V DC
|
| Output delay time |
OFF to ON: 20 µs nominal, 50 µs maximum, ON to OFF: 60 µs nominal, 300 µs maximum
|
| Rate measurement, max |
500 khz
|
| Reverse polarity protection |
Yes (if wired incorrectly, module outputs can be permanently disabled.)
|
| Short circuit protection |
Electronic (remove overload and toggle On/Off to restore.)
|
| Surge current per point |
2 A for 10 ms every 1 s @ 60 °C (140 °F)
|
| RTB keying |
User-defined mechanical
|
|---|---|
| Shock |
Operating: 30 G, Non operating: 50 G
|
| Slot width |
1
|
| Vibration |
2 G @ 10...500 Hz
|
| Enclosure type |
None (open-style)
|
